To permit the optimum stabilized suspended heating by a method wherein the positions of upper and lower external four polarized ring electrodes are deviated from the position of a central electrode and voltages, applied on the electrodes, are changed while providing phase differences in the vertical direction while the strength of electric field in the vertical direction is rotated into one direction.
Voltages, applied on upper external four polarized ring electrodes 15b and lower external four polarized ring electrodes 15d are changed with phase differences in accordance with the rotation of suspended material 11 whereby the strength of electric field about the material 11 is rotated in the vertical direction. On the other hand, the position of irradiation of irradiating position movable type heating laser against the material 11 is changed up-and-down and left-and-right in accordance with the rotation of the suspended material 11. In this case, an oxygen partial pressure regulating device discharges or absorbs oxygen in accordance with the change of oxygen concentration in atmospheric gas in a chamber. Further, a magnet, arranged on the upper central electrode, bends the passage of electron 13, generated from the electrodes, into directions deviated from the material 11.
